France to evacuate its citizens if the crisis between Turkey and Greece grows

FRENCH MINISTER IN CYPRUS

While the tension between Turkey and Greece is rising rapidly, an anti-Turkish move has come from France and Southern Cyprus. It was reported that French Foreign Minister Catherine Colonna and her Cypriot counterpart Yannis Kasoulidis had signed an agreement in Paris yesterday, f acilitating the evacuation of the French during a possible crisis.

The Southern Cypriot press reported that French Minister Colonna had criticized Turkey’s recent rhetoric towards Greece and Southern Cyprus during the meeting. Colonna said that ”Turkey’s aggressive rhetoric had increased instability in the region,” and the evacuation agreement had been signed due to rising tensions.

It was noted that the South Cypriot minister Kasulidis had also conveyed his ideas on the solution of the Cyprus problem to the French minister.

FRENCH MINISTER HAD MADE ANTI-TURKEY STATEMENTS IN ATHENS

French Foreign Minister Colonna, who came to Turkey earlier this week and met with his counterpart Mevlut Cavusoglu, had made anti-Turkish statements in Athens, where she later went. Speaking to the Greek newspaper Kathimerini, Colonna had made a statement of support for Greece in the growing tension between Turkey and Greece. Colonna had also claimed that Turkey was using the refugee crisis as a weapon to destabilize the European Union.
